Dunes Station was the second Survival Railway Network East Line station on Survival 2. Built atop a large hill in the desert, the station was small and open-air, having an iron trapdoor roof sitting atop acacia log pillars. The station was originally designed and built by then-line manager Aeghu, however it was never completed. When William278 was appointed as the new East Line Manager, he finished the build and the connection from East Station and Dunes Station was opened on the 5th of May, 2018.

In addition to the main two lines that depart from the station, two secondary line terminals were built, however never used. The station was also connected via NTN. Following the station's completion, the area around the station was developed into the town of Saharia. The station also neighbored Great Dune Bridge, one of the largest bridges on the network, which connected between Dunes and Solace Station.
